The Southern African grape season finishes on a high note.
2025-04-11 17:00
During what some exporters described as the "most pleasant" table grape season in many years, South Africa increased its export crop by 5 percent, shipping a record volume of 77.4 million cartons.

Increased production of Mexican avocados by 2025
2025-04-11 10:00
Mexico is expected to produce 2.75 million tonnes of avocados in 2025, which is 3 percent more than the total of 2.67 million tonnes in 2024. This increase is due to favorable growing conditions, improved agricultural practices, and strong export demand.
